Write For Us

Heroes of the Storm Tychus Findlay Trailer

E-Commerce Solutions SEO Solutions Marketing Solutions
253 Views
Published
StarCraft's Tychus Findlay is showing up in Blizzard's upcoming MOBA, Heroes of the Storm.
Category
IGN
Sign in or sign up to post comments.
Be the first to comment